A Graduate Certificate in Coastal Conservation Biology provides specialized training in the science and management of coastal ecosystems. Students develop expertise in various areas, equipping them for roles in conservation and management.
Learning outcomes typically include a deep understanding of coastal biodiversity, habitat restoration techniques, and the impact of climate change on coastal environments. Students gain practical skills in data analysis, research methodologies, and conservation planning relevant to coastal zones and marine protected areas. This includes hands-on experience with fieldwork and advanced ecological modeling.
The program duration is generally designed to be completed within one year of part-time study or less, offering flexibility for working professionals seeking to enhance their expertise in coastal conservation. Specific program lengths can vary slightly depending on the institution offering the program.
